From: The effectiveness of a stage-based lifestyle modification intervention for obese children
Variable | All | Intervention | Control | χ2 value | P value |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
(n = 40) | (n = 20) | (n = 20) | |||
n (%) | n (%) | n (%) | |||
Age (years) | |||||
 7–9 | 17 (42.5) | 8 (20.0) | 9 (22.5) | 0.102 | 0.749 |
 10–11 | 23 (57.5) | 12 (30.0) | 11 (27.5) |  |  |
Gender | |||||
 Boys | 21 (52.5) | 11 (27.5) | 10 (25.0) | 0.100 | 0.752 |
 Girls | 19 (47.5) | 9 (22.5) | 10 (25.0) |  |  |
Ethnicity | |||||
 Malay | 38 (95.0) | 19 (47.5) | 19 (47.5) | 0.000 | 1.000 |
 Non-Malay | 2 (5.0) | 1 (2.5) | 1 (2.5) |  |  |
Father’s educational level | |||||
 Primary or secondary education | 17 (42.5) | 9 (22.5) | 8 (20.0) | 0.102 | 0.749 |
 Tertiary education | 23 (57.5) | 11 (27.5) | 12 (30) |  |  |
Mother’s educational level | |||||
 Primary or secondary education | 17 (42.5) | 8 (20.0) | 9 (22.5) | 0.102 | 0.749 |
 Tertiary education | 23 (57.5) | 12 (30) | 11 (27.5) |  |  |
Current estimated household income | |||||
 RM 2001 to RM 5000 | 9 (22.5) | 4 (10.0) | 5 (12.5) | 0.143 | 0.705 |
  > RM 5000 | 31 (77.5) | 16 (40.0) | 15 (37.5) |  |  |
